{"product_id":"the-curious-history-of-the-heart-9780231208185","title":"The Curious History of the Heart","description":"\u003cb\u003eBook Synopsis\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This book traces the evolution of our understanding of the heart from the dawn of civilization to the present. Vincent M. Figueredo—an accomplished cardiologist and expert on the history of the human heart—explores the role and significance of the heart in art, culture, religion, philosophy, and science across time and place.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eTrade Review\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eVincent Figueredo helps us to understand the heart as a cultural symbol, biological miracle, and central theme in human history.
